Vue3 是基于组件化的渐进式 JavaScript 框架,采用 Composition API 增强逻辑复用与代码组织,通过 Proxy 实现响应式系统,具备更小的体积、更好的性能及更灵活的开发体验。

Vue3源码解析之虚拟DOM:深入理解diff算法与性能优化

本文深入解析了 Vue3 中虚拟 DOM 的相关知识,包括虚拟 DOM 的概念、diff 算法的作用、Vue3 中 diff 算法的优化等内容。通过详细的示例,让读者更好地理解这些核心知识点。同时,分析了虚拟 DOM 和 diff 算法的应用场景、优缺点以及注意事项。对于想要深入了解 Vue3 性能优化的开发者来说,是一篇非常实用的技术博客。

Vue3生态库的升级与兼容性处理:从Vue2到Vue3,插件、UI库与工具链的平滑迁移经验

本文详细介绍了从Vue2到Vue3升级时,生态库的升级与兼容性处理。包括插件、UI库和工具链的平滑迁移经验,通过具体示例展示了Vue2与Vue3的差异,以及在升级过程中的注意事项和应用场景。帮助开发者更好地完成从Vue2到Vue3的迁移。

TypeScript与Vue3组合式API:类型安全的状态管理方案

本文详细介绍了TypeScript与Vue3组合式API结合的状态管理方案。首先解释了TypeScript和Vue3组合式API的概念,接着阐述了使用它们进行状态管理的应用场景、优缺点和注意事项。通过多个具体示例,展示了如何使用TypeScript和Vue3组合式API进行简单和复杂的状态管理,以及如何在组件中使用这些状态。最后总结了这种组合的优势,强调了其在实际开发中的价值。

Vue3渲染函数进阶:JSX语法在复杂组件中的应用实践

本文详细介绍了 JSX 语法在 Vue3 复杂组件中的应用实践。从基础认知入手,讲解了 JSX 语法的优点和使用场景,如动态组件渲染和循环渲染列表。同时分析了 JSX 语法的技术优缺点,并给出了使用时的注意事项。通过丰富的示例,帮助不同基础的开发者理解和掌握这一技术。

Vue3新特性provide/inject进阶:解决跨组件层级数据传递难题

本文详细介绍了Vue3中provide/inject特性,用于解决跨组件层级数据传递难题。首先阐述了传统数据传递的问题,接着介绍了provide/inject的基本用法和进阶用法,包括响应式数据传递和注入默认值。还列举了主题切换、全局配置等应用场景,分析了该技术的优缺点和注意事项。通过丰富的示例,帮助开发者更好地理解和应用这一特性。

Vue3组合式API实战指南,告别选项式开发的局限性

本文详细介绍了Vue3组合式API,对比了与选项式API的差异,阐述了其应用场景,如复杂组件开发和代码复用。分析了技术的优缺点,优点包括代码结构清晰、复用性强等,缺点是学习成本较高。同时给出了使用时的注意事项,如响应式数据和生命周期钩子的使用。最后总结了Vue3组合式API的优势,鼓励开发者学习使用。

Vue3响应式原理剖析与常见问题排查指南

本文深入剖析了Vue3的响应式原理,通过详细示例介绍了reactive和ref的使用,讲解了Proxy代理和依赖收集机制。同时探讨了Vue3响应式的应用场景,分析了其优缺点,提供了常见问题排查指南和注意事项。适合不同基础的开发者阅读,帮助大家更好地理解和运用Vue3的响应式特性。

Vue3响应式数组处理陷阱:如何正确操作数组避免视图不更新

本文主要探讨了Vue3响应式数组处理时容易遇到的陷阱,如直接通过索引修改元素和修改数组长度导致视图不更新的问题。详细介绍了正确操作数组的方法,包括使用Vue3提供的方法和数组原生方法。结合列表展示、数据筛选与排序等应用场景进行分析,阐述了技术的优缺点和注意事项,帮助开发者更好地使用Vue3响应式数组。

Vue3组合式API最佳实践:提升代码可维护性

本文详细介绍了Vue3组合式API提升代码可维护性的方法。首先介绍了组合式API的基础,包括基本概念和使用示例。接着阐述了提升代码可维护性的实践方法,如逻辑提取成函数、模块化管理和状态管理等。还分析了应用场景、技术优缺点和注意事项。通过这些内容,帮助开发者更好地掌握Vue3组合式API,提高代码的可维护性。

Vue3响应式原理深度解析:如何避免常见的数据更新失效问题

本文深度解析了Vue3的响应式原理,详细介绍了如何使用reactive和ref函数创建响应式数据,以及常见的数据更新失效问题及解决方法。同时,还介绍了Vue3响应式原理的应用场景、技术优缺点和注意事项。通过本文的学习,开发者可以更好地理解和应用Vue3的响应式原理,避免常见的数据更新失效问题。

JavaScript Vue3 指令开发:自定义指令实现、钩子函数与参数传递

本文详细介绍了在Vue3中开发自定义指令的相关内容,包括自定义指令的实现步骤、钩子函数的使用以及参数传递方法。通过丰富的示例展示了如何定义全局和局部指令,如何利用不同的钩子函数在元素生命周期的不同阶段执行操作,以及如何通过传递值、表达式和修饰符让指令更加灵活。同时还分析了自定义指令的应用场景、技术优缺点和注意事项,帮助开发者更好地掌握和运用自定义指令,提高开发效率。

TypeScript 前端工程化:类型定义、接口设计与 Vue3/React 项目集成实践

本文深入探讨了 TypeScript 在前端工程化中的应用,包括基础类型定义、接口设计,以及与 Vue3 和 React 项目的集成实践。详细介绍了 TypeScript 的使用方法和优势,分析了其应用场景、优缺点和注意事项。通过丰富的示例代码,帮助开发者更好地理解和掌握 TypeScript 在前端开发中的应用,提升代码质量和开发效率。

Vue项目白屏问题排查与性能优化实践

本文详细介绍了Vue项目白屏问题的排查方法和性能优化实践。通过具体示例,阐述了资源加载问题、代码报错问题、路由配置问题等导致白屏的原因及排查方法。同时,介绍了代码分割、缓存组件、优化图片资源等性能优化方法。还分析了应用场景、技术优缺点和注意事项,为开发者解决Vue项目中的白屏和性能问题提供了实用的参考。

Vue项目打包体积过大的优化策略与实践

本文详细介绍了Vue项目打包体积过大的各种优化策略,包括按需引入第三方库、路由懒加载、代码分割、资源压缩等实用技巧,帮助开发者显著减小打包体积,提升应用性能。
1 页,共 6(111 篇文章)
跳至
1 / 6
下一页